Output 3b29b08c24ae390a085ec438821ccc0b4382f8adcad0d79c14a9ce7febe879f5:156

value
1634644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23f77de22bab53d759ac3b4e8d57e683cb830c67 OP_EQUAL
address
34yC4HUUvgkWu8VXZ6N1tAkqg8WKckMvHd
transaction
3b29b08c24ae390a085ec438821ccc0b4382f8adcad0d79c14a9ce7febe879f5
spent
true